Does Avengers Endgame Full Movie HD Have Post-Credit Scenes?

5 Answers2026-04-02 06:25:54

Oh, the post-credit scenes in 'Avengers: Endgame' are such a hot topic! I remember sitting in the theater, completely drained after that emotional rollercoaster, and then—bam—the credits hit. But wait, is there more? For this one, Marvel actually broke their usual pattern. Unlike most MCU films, 'Endgame' doesn’t have a mid- or post-credit scene. It’s just the credits rolling with that satisfying metallic clinking sound honoring the original six Avengers.

I think it was a deliberate choice. The movie was already packed with closure, and adding another teaser might’ve undercut the finale’s weight. But hey, if you stayed hoping for one, at least you got to hear that iconic sound design—a nice little nod to the journey.

What Endgame Gear Completes A Torchlight 2 Outlander Build?

3 Answers2025-12-30 07:08:33

My go-to endgame kit for an Outlander in 'Torchlight II' focuses on making every shot count—fast, sharp, and brutal. I build around dual pistols that have very high attack speed and crit modifiers, so ideally both weapons will roll with +critical hit chance, +critical damage, and flat physical or elemental projectile damage. For the off-hand you can double-down with a second pistol or pick a focus that grants +projectile damage and +skill levels for your main attack, depending on whether you want raw DPS or boosted skills.

Armor choices lean light: a chest piece with dodge, elemental resist, and a big life pool is lifesaving. Helm and gloves should stack crit chance, attack speed, or crit damage—gloves with attack speed + crit are a jackpot. Boots for movement speed and dodge let you kite bosses; belt with extra HP and armor helps your survivability. For jewelry, aim for two rings and an amulet that together push your crit chance into the sweet spot and provide either life steal or on-hit elemental damage. A relic that increases projectile pierce or adds conditional on-hit effects will round things out.

Sockets are huge—slot in gems that amplify your primary damage type (physical or elemental) and a survivability gem in your chest. Enchantments and pet gear can fill gaps like +resist or extra health. In practice I run this set with mobility skills and a pet that distracts trash; it feels slick, lethal, and just a bit reckless in the best way.

What Are The Best Darksiders Weapons For Endgame Bosses?

3 Answers2026-01-24 01:49:18

I get excited every time someone asks about cut-through-the-boss gear for the 'Darksiders' family, so here's my long-winded, nerdy take. For War, his sword — the iconic Chaoseater — is still king when you want raw, staggery damage. What I look for late-game are versions with big flat damage boosts plus armor-piercing or enemy-stagger perks; those let you break a boss’s guard quickly and follow with a heavy finisher. If you’ve been maxing upgrades, the attack chains that add knockback or an AoE shockwave turn single-target encounters into manageable windows where you can punish recovery frames.

For Death in 'Darksiders II', I favor the fastest scythes or paired scythe sets that boost combo multipliers and critical chance. Death’s playstyle benefits massively from hit-and-run: high attack speed + lifesteal or wrath generation keeps you alive against extended boss phases. I also love weapons that add debuffs — poison or slow — because they let your minions or abilities chip away while you reposition. For Fury in 'Darksiders III', the whip's elemental variants are brilliant: go for Whips that add burst magic or elemental status that exploits a boss’s weakness; swapping forms mid-fight (if you’ve invested in those upgrades) lets you pressure different phases with appropriate damage types.

Across all of them, prioritize weapons that synergize with your highest-upgraded skills and relics. Legendary or enhanced weapons that add on-hit effects (lifesteal, bleed, stun) will trump raw base numbers if they let you control the rhythm of the fight. And don’t sleep on crafting or enchantment paths that increase critical damage and reduce cooldowns — those quality-of-life boosts are what make endgame bosses feel beatable rather than tedious. I’ve taken down the toughest encounters by leaning into stagger -> burst -> heal cycles, and a good weapon that supports that loop makes all the difference.

What Gear Is Optimal For Perilous Moons Osrs Endgame Fights?

3 Answers2026-02-03 13:31:42

Min-maxing gear builds is half the thrill of tackling high-end bosses, so here’s the kit I swear by when Perilous Moons throws its nastiest challenges at you. For pure melee single-target fights I favor a stab/precision approach: Ghrazi rapier for its fast, consistent hits, backed by an Abyssal bludgeon when I need crush damage or when armour-rending mechanics matter. I pair those with Bandos chest and tassets for strength and survivability, Primordial boots for that melee boost, and an Amulet of torture. For defence and utility I keep an Avernic defender (or the best defender you have) and an Infernal/Fire cape depending on budget.

When the fight pivots to ranged or dragon-type mechanics, my go-to changes: Twisted bow if the boss’s magic scaling makes it worthwhile, otherwise Toxic blowpipe with addy/dragon darts for sustained DPS. Armadyl chest or Karil top, Pegasian boots, and a Necklace of anguish round out the set. For magic-heavy phases I switch into Kodai wand or Trident of the swamp, paired with a high-mage-accuracy robe top, ancestral-style or Ahrim alternatives if you don’t have endgame robes, and an Occult neck. Always bring a Dragon warhammer or BGS on the side for emergency defence drops.

Inventory and extras matter more than people admit: prayer potions, super restores, brews, a few high-heal foods, and sometimes a breaching set (stuns, entangles) or a special weapon for mechanics. For team fights I slot in one or two people with defence-lowering specials and someone dedicated to cleansing or debuffs. Honestly, the right mix of weapons, boots, and a defence breaker will make Perilous Moons feel beatable — I still grin every time a carefully prepped setup eats a boss phase for breakfast.
